Welcome to Hospital for Veterinary Dentistry and Oral Surgery, a premier destination for specialized veterinary care focused on dental health and oral surgery. Located in Matthews, NC, our hospital is dedicated to providing high-quality services tailored to the unique needs of pets. Our team of expert veterinarians, led by Dr. Steffes, brings extensive experience and expertise in addressing complex dental and oral health issues, ensuring your pet receives the care they deserve.
At Hospital for Veterinary Dentistry and Oral Surgery, we understand that dental health is a critical component of overall pet wellness. Many pets suffer from undiagnosed dental problems, which can lead to severe pain, infection, and other serious health complications. Our hospital is equipped with state-of-the-art facilities and advanced technologies to provide comprehensive care for your furry friends. From routine dental cleanings to complex oral surgeries, we are here to help your pet maintain optimal oral health.
- Specialized Services: We offer a wide range of services including dental cleanings, extractions, oral surgery, treatment of periodontal disease, and management of other complex dental conditions. Our expertise extends to advanced procedures such as mandibulectomy and reconstruction, ensuring that even the most challenging cases are handled with care and precision.

Oct 07, 2024 · Jenn B.Dr. Steffes and team are outstanding! My kitty’s lower mandible was fractured during a routine dental cleaning with a General Practice Vet. The GP Vet extracted his lower canines without notifying me or informing me of any risks (this procedure is extremely technical and challenging to perform due to the fragile nature of a cat’s mandible). My kitty’s jaw looked disfigured when I brought him home and within a few days he was exhibiting an extreme pain reaction. He also developed a foul odor in his mouth. I increasingly grew concerned and brought him back to the GP Vet to seek additional medical attention. I showed her his disfigured jaw, his lip was splayed out and his baby incisors collapsed inside his mouth. She dismissed my cat’s situation and stated that if his jaw was fractured it would heal on its own. She also did not address his raging oral infection. She told me to manage my expectations and that he can never eat dry food again because his jaw will be sore. She told me to schedule a follow visit in 2 weeks. As I left there feeling demoralized and scared for my kitty’s wellbeing, I reached out to Dr. Steffes and her incredible team of highly skilled, properly trained, and qualified dental and oral vet experts. Karen in customer service answered my first call and within hours she connected me to Sara, dental vet tech specialist and liaison to the practice. Sara quickly called me to discuss my case and consulted me on my kitty’s likely fractured jaw. She sent pertinent information to Dr. Steffes for her to review my case. Within 1 day, Sara called me back and scheduled me to bring my kitty to VDOS for emergency surgery (suspected jaw fracture). I took my kitty to VDOS the next morning and we met with Shelby, dental specialist vet tech. She was thorough and kind and walked me through how things would unfold throughout the day. I felt confident leaving my kitty in their hands. That afternoon, I received the call from Dr. Steffes. She had examined my kitty and informed me that he had a bad infection in his jaw and that his mandible was irreparably damaged from the GP Vet lower canine extractions. She confirmed her findings with a CT scan and walked me through her recommendation - a mandibulectomy. Dr. Steffes assured me that this type of procedure was her forte and that my kitty would do well, be pain free, comfortable and able resume a normal QOL. We proceeded. I arrived late in the afternoon to pick up my kitty and Dr. Steffes and Shelby sat with me for an hour reviewing their findings. Our discussion underscored how important it is to seek out qualified, highly trained veterinary specialists when considering care options for companion pets. I’m inspired by the humanity and compassionate care Dr. Steffes and team extended to me and my beloved kitty. Dr. Steffes is an excellent oral surgeon. Dr. Steffes and her team saved my kitty’s life and I will forever be grateful. I’ve included three photos for reference. The first photo shows what my kitty looked like before his broken jaw. Second photo of my kitty with broken jaw from GP vet lower canine extractions jaw - he was in a lot of pain in this photo. The third photo shows my angel resting peacefully with his newly resected jaw - his tongue will now hang out from time to time.
